Girl Dinner Pasta Board (Printable)

A vibrant platter combining three pasta types, grilled chicken, and rich sauces for a flavorful meal.

# What You Need:

→ Pastas

01 - 3.5 oz spaghetti
02 - 3.5 oz penne
03 - 3.5 oz farfalle

→ Chicken

04 - 2 boneless, skinless chicken breasts
05 - 1 tbsp olive oil
06 - 1 tsp Italian seasoning
07 - Salt and pepper, to taste

→ Sauces

08 - 1 cup marinara sauce
09 - 1 cup Alfredo sauce
10 - 1 cup pesto sauce

→ Toppings & Garnishes

11 - ½ cup grated Parmesan cheese
12 - ½ cup cherry tomatoes, halved
13 - ¼ cup fresh basil leaves
14 - ¼ cup black olives, sliced
15 - 1 tbsp extra-virgin olive oil

# Directions:

01 - Bring a large pot of salted water to a rolling boil. Cook spaghetti, penne, and farfalle individually according to package directions. Drain each, then toss with a drizzle of olive oil to prevent sticking. Set aside.
02 - Preheat grill pan or skillet over medium-high heat. Coat chicken breasts with olive oil, Italian seasoning, salt, and pepper.
03 - Grill chicken breasts for 5 to 7 minutes per side until internal temperature reaches 75°C (165°F) and juices run clear. Rest for 5 minutes before slicing into strips.
04 - Gently heat marinara, Alfredo, and pesto sauces separately in small saucepans over low heat until warmed through.
05 - Arrange the three pasta varieties in distinct sections on a large serving platter.
06 - Place grilled chicken strips alongside pasta and present each sauce in small bowls on the platter.
07 - Distribute Parmesan cheese, cherry tomatoes, basil leaves, and sliced olives in small piles or bowls on the board.
08 - Drizzle extra-virgin olive oil over the pasta just before serving.
09 - Encourage guests to mix and match pastas, sauces, and garnishes as desired for a playful experience.

02 -
  • Do not skip resting the chicken—slicing it hot turns tender meat dry and sad.
  • Toss the pasta with oil immediately after draining or it will fuse into one giant noodle clump by the time you plate.
03 -
  • Use a wooden board or a rimmed baking sheet lined with parchment—it contains spills and makes cleanup easier.
  • Drizzle the extra-virgin olive oil over the pasta just before serving so it glistens and smells like summer.
